Although it can reach a height of 20ft (6m) tall, the plant generally remains a low twisted shrub with spreading branches.
The spikey blue-green needles are in groups of three, each has a white band on upper sides.
Berries are green in first year and ripen to dark purple in the second year.
Juniper is one of Britain's native conifers and occurs naturally in a variety of situations: in the south it grows on chalk downs and is one of the stages in the formation of a beech wood. Further north it grows on moorland while in Scotland it flourishes on the acid soils of pine forests.
The berries are still used for flavouring gin
